OK, I'm running low on my bag of tricks,  as is my custom when I get
desperate, I consult the council!

I have a series of seven DL380's using 10GB 2 port NICs which are HP 560
SFP adapters.  Using the same configuration on each host, I've been able to
get network on six of them, using CentOS 6.7; config files follow

As near as I can tell, the only difference between the one without network,
and the 6 that do, is the six that do have two of the 10GB nics, and the
one without, has one.  (2 ports to each NIC)

Ethtool shows no link, ip link show, shows BROADCAST, MULTICAST, UP,  state
unknown.

(scratches head)   If I'm missing something, I sure don't know what it is.
Got my networking guy to show me a copy of the switch port config, it's
identical for all ports.  My onsite guy assures me it's plugged in and
they've got link light on the cable.

If I'm missing something, it sure isn't jumping out at me.  So all advice
is appreciated.
Is there a way to tell definitively which ethernet I need configure?  In
case maybe it's not eth0?   Unlikely - since the other six came up fine
when I configured eth0, but I'm running low on ideas.
